==== Phabricator ====
A quieter month?
- 818 active users in Wikimedia Phabricator during November (was 885
in October).[
https://www.mediawiki.org/wiki/Community_metrics#Active_users_in_Phabricator ]
- 255 new accounts in Wikimedia Phabricator (was 348 in
October).[
https://www.mediawiki.org/wiki/Community_metrics#New_accounts_in_Phabricator ]
